Brexit scholar says Alberta referendum gives him 'a feeling of déjà vu'
A scholar overseas says "Brexit has a lot of lessons to teach Albertans" about the dangers of a vote on separation, with October's referendum on the question of separation drawing comparisons to what he and Prime Minister Mark Carney call the ill-fated vote for the United Kingdom to leave the European Union.
